Beyond Surface-Level Causes
Some argue that actions like America's military presence in Saudi Arabia incite groups like Al Qaeda. This view oversimplifies the issue. The root of the conflict with Al Qaeda, spearheaded by Osama Bin Laden, relates more to personal pride than territorial disputes.
In 1991, during Saddam Hussein's invasion of Kuwait, Saudi Arabia sought protection for its vital oil fields. Bin Laden offered the services of his Mujahideen, who resisted Soviet forces in Afghanistan. However, Saudi Arabia opted for U.S. assistance, wounding Bin Laden's pride. His campaign is thus a quest to position himself as Islam's true defender, not merely a response to Western presence.
